Cost of Living: Blacksburg, VA vs Los Angeles, CA

Quick rent-and-take-home comparison

Using a baseline of $70,000/yr gross, take-home is about $4,181/mo in Blacksburg, VA versus $3,974/mo in Los Angeles, CA. In the model, rent is about 18.81% of gross in Blacksburg, VA versus 25.99% in Los Angeles, CA, so Blacksburg, VA tends to feel more affordable for rent.

At a glance

  • Cheaper overall (lower cost-of-living index): Blacksburg, VA
  • Lower rent (median 1BR/2BR): Blacksburg, VA
  • Lower home prices: Blacksburg, VA
  • Higher median household income: Los Angeles, CA

Cost of Living Index

Blacksburg, VA: 100 (U.S. = 100) · Los Angeles, CA: 148.6 (U.S. = 100)

Blacksburg, VA has a lower cost-of-living index than Los Angeles, CA, so a given salary generally stretches further there.

Median Rent

Blacksburg, VA: $1,226/mo (midpoint of 1BR/2BR) · Los Angeles, CA: $1,695/mo

Median rent in Los Angeles, CA is $469/mo higher than in Blacksburg, VA.

Median Home Price

Blacksburg, VA: $417,200 · Los Angeles, CA: $657,700

Median home price in Los Angeles, CA is $240,500 higher than in Blacksburg, VA.

Median Household Income

Blacksburg, VA: $48,070 · Los Angeles, CA: $74,785

Los Angeles, CA has a higher median household income than Blacksburg, VA by $26,715.
